Urgent warning to iPhone users

Tech experts have issued an urgent warning to all iPhone users after discovering a new cyber attack targeting App "IDs".

Axar.az reports that the warning states that hackers use SMS phishing campaigns to steal user data.

The app has set rules for such an attack, urging App owners to use two-factor authentication, which requires a password and a six-digit verification code to access their accounts.
